Babe Didrikson

    • Born: June 26, 1911
    • Birth Place: Port Arthur Texas
    • Died: September 27, 1956
    • Babe won gold medals for the javelin and hurdles and was awarded the silver medal in the high jump during the 1932 Olympics.
    • In 1948, Babe won the U.S. Women's Open, the World Championship and the All-American Open in golf.
    • She was given the nickname "Babe" during sandlot baseball games with the neighborhood boys, who thought she batted like Babe Ruth.
    • She married George Zaharias, a well known professional wrestler and sports promoter, on December 23, 1938.

  • Babe Didrikson - Zaharias was a phenomenal female athlete. She was accomplished in basketball, track, golf, baseball, tennis, swimming, diving, boxing, volleyball, handball, bowling, billiards, skating and cycling.
